Pipe Leak Detection Questions
How can I tell if I have a pipe leak? Signs include unexplained water bills, damp spots, or the sound of running water when fixtures are off.
What areas are typically checked during leak detection? Common areas include underground pipes, behind walls, and under concrete slabs where leaks often occur.
Are pipe leaks only a problem in older homes? No, leaks can happen in any property due to aging pipes, high water pressure, or damage from freezing temperatures.
What methods are used for leak detection? Techniques include electronic listening devices, thermal imaging, and pressure testing to locate leaks accurately.
